Saving Your Frame to A Folder (Ctrl+E)
While the movie is playing, save (Ctrl+E) your desired frame to a designated folder. Saved image files may be viewed in C:\Program Files\GRETECH\GomPlayer\Capture.
TIP: Capturing an image with subtitles
To capture an image including its subtitles, click on Preferences (F5) -> Subtitle -> Display On Video (TV-OUT) under Display Method.
To capture an image without subtitles, click Display On Overlay Surface under Display Method.
Advanced Screen Capture
Advanced Screen Capture helps you change the saved file�s directory, and capture up to 10 burst images in a row.
While the movie is playing, click Advanced Screen Capture (Ctrl+G)
- Change the directory of the saved file and view it C:\ProgramFiles\GRETECH\GomPlayer\Capture.

Burst Capture Settings:
- Burst Capture Images: If you set to 10, you can get 10 image files when clicking Burst Capture.
- Burst Interval (sec): If you set to 5, you can get a frame every 5 seconds.
- Result of Burst Capture
- Set at default, Burst Capture will capture 10 image files in a row.
